Garage Gutter Cleaning in Longmont, CO
Garage gutter cleaning services focus on removing debris, leaves, and dirt from the gutters and downspouts that surround a garage. This service helps ensure that rainwater flows freely away from the structure, preventing water buildup that can cause damage to the foundation, siding, or interior of the garage. Projects typically include clearing out blockages, flushing the gutters to check for proper drainage, and inspecting the system for any signs of damage or need for repairs. Property owners often request this service when gutters appear clogged, during seasonal maintenance, or as part of preparing a property for adverse weather conditions.
Before requesting gutter cleaning, property owners usually want to understand the scope of work involved, including whether the service covers both the gutters and downspouts, and if any additional repairs are recommended. It’s also helpful to know if the service includes inspection for potential issues such as leaks, sagging sections, or loose fasteners. Clarifying these details helps ensure that the gutters are thoroughly cleaned and maintained to protect the property from water-related damage.

Common Garage Gutter Cleaning Jobs
Garage gutter cleaning - removes debris to prevent water overflow and damage.
Gutter inspection services - identifies blockages and potential issues before they cause problems.
Downspout clearing - ensures proper water flow away from the garage foundation.
Debris removal from gutters - keeps gutters free of leaves, twigs, and dirt buildup.
Gutter flushing - uses water to clear out dirt and ensure smooth drainage.
Gutter maintenance - helps prolong gutter lifespan and maintain proper function.
Garage Gutter Cleaning Questions
What is garage gutter cleaning? Garage gutter cleaning involves removing debris and buildup from the gutters attached to a garage to ensure proper drainage.
Why is gutter cleaning important for garages? Regular cleaning prevents water damage, foundation issues, and pest problems caused by clogged gutters.
How often should garage gutters be cleaned? It is recommended to clean gutters at least twice a year or more frequently if there are many trees nearby.
What types of debris are typically removed during gutter cleaning? Leaves, twigs, dirt, and other blockages that can obstruct water flow are commonly removed during the service.
